Final Fantasy XV has been delayed

Final Fantasy XV has been delayed On August 14th a collective groan was heard throughout the Final Fantasy fandom. Final Fantasy XV would not be released on September 30th but on November 29th. Developer Square Enix announced on that the global released would be delayed; they gave this message on August 25th as to why…
